Output 0e601a5ce2096d56b1b810ac580339964acaf53358ec4dbea4e379d26b40bd54:28

value
2513025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944444d9749191bb569bb222ac84694127de3737 OP_EQUAL
address
3FCyiLuQN9KYCVVdPYRoareqsJhcjyZR6Y
transaction
0e601a5ce2096d56b1b810ac580339964acaf53358ec4dbea4e379d26b40bd54
confirmations
179227
spent
true